
BMW Canada is pleased to announce the introduction of the 2011 BMW 335is Coupé and Cabriolet, each destined to take a place in history among the line of desirable, often collectible BMW "s" models.
Based on the newly-updated 2011 BMW 3 Series Coupé and Convertible, the new 2011 BMW 335is features the award-winning, twin-turbocharged BMW inline-6 engine, specially tuned and equipped to produce 320 horsepower and 332 lb-ft of torque from its 3.0-liters, and a standard 6-speed manual transmission. For the first time on a "non- M" version of the BMW 3 Series in Canada, the 7-speed Double Clutch Transmission (DCT) will be available as an option. So equipped, the 335is Coupé will be capable of 0-100 km/h acceleration in 5.3 seconds. The 2011 BMW 335is will go on sale late this spring, and pricing will be announced closer to the on-sale date.
Fundamentally unchanged are the BMW 3 Series` essential attributes of rear-wheel drive, near-perfect 50-50 weight distribution, remarkably precise steering, and skillfully engineered suspension...all of which conspire to produce the uniquely satisfying driving experience that is quintessentially BMW.
